Description
Summary:Nucleate pool boiling of distilled water on a plain copper surface has been investigated experimentally and modeled numerically. In the experimental study, bubble behavior on a single nucleation site was observed using high-speed photography and long-distance microscopy. Diameter for a single bubble growth was determined during the ebullition cycle via recordings. Numerical simulations have been carried out using CLSVOF method using ANSYS 18.2. To verify the simulation, the bubble growth period is compared with the results of the experimental study. Data from the numerical results compare reasonably well with the experimental study.
